Dean of Student Development Robin Hart Ruthenbeck completed bachelor's and master's degrees at Miami University in Oxford, Ohio, after which she spent time at a number of institutions throughout the Midwest, including DePauw University, Carleton College and Macalester College. Her roles in residential life, academic advising, orientation and transition programs, campus programs, leadership, and accessibility services provided a solid foundation as a generalist in student affairs. In 2015, Robin earned her Ed.D. at the University of Minnesota, where her research explored students in transition and how their development of a sense of belonging was impacted by social networking. Robin and her husband Paul enjoy spending time outdoors (camping, hiking, practicing photography) with their dog, Titus.
